Building On Their Reputation 5/9/16

"Their set started with a couple of explosive Rock numbers that demanded everybody’s attention, and soon had the audience tapping along to the beat. They then showed their softer, more sensitive side by performing latest single 'Towers', with its powerful guitar and authentic Blues twang, which also made the most of Andy’s smooth yet sharp vocals. The raw energy of 'Surrender' raised the pace again, setting the scene for the accelerating rhythm and passionate vocals of 'Close To Nowhere'. This song’s repetitive guitar and drum riff were cleverly used to build up to the explosive chorus, a fitting finale for Cortes’s set: as it finished the roaring applause was inevitable."
